Handling payment receipts with a receipt store
First Claim
1. A method of providing a receipt, the method comprising:
- engaging in a point-of-sale transaction with a customer in which said customer is physically present at a location at which the transaction occurs, said transaction not being performed through a commerce system that facilitates remote network transactions;
receiving, from a device carried by said customer, profile information that is stored on said device and that comprises contact information that identifies, by an e-mail address, an Instant Message (IM) address, a Uniform Resource Locator (URL), a phone number, or a Short Message Service (SMS) identifier, a location to which said receipt is to be sent, said profile information being received at a device reader that communicates with said device and that is communicatively connected to a point-of-sale component and that is separate from said point-of-sale component;
generating said receipt based on said transaction by creating, at said point-of-sale component, a partial receipt that does not include an amount paid by said customer for transaction and does not include a form of payment used for said transaction, and by transmitting said partial receipt to said device reader, said device reader creating said receipt from said partial receipt by said device reader'"'"'s adding said amount paid and said form of payment to said partial receipt; and
causing said receipt to be sent, via a network, to a receipt store identified by said contact information, wherein said receipt store is remote from said location at which said transaction occurs.

Abstract
A receipt store may be provided as a service. Electronic payment receipts generated in any type of transaction may be delivered to the receipt store. A customer may subscribe to a particular receipt store, to be used as a repository for that customer'"'"'s receipts. The customer may carry a device that is used to communicate payment information (such as a credit card number) to a device reader when purchases are made. The device may also identify the customer'"'"'s receipt store. A commercial establishment that accepts the customer'"'"'s payment may generate an electronic receipt, and may deliver it to the receipt store specified by the customer'"'"'s device. The establishment may also deliver the receipt to the customer'"'"'s device, and the customer'"'"'s device may send the receipt along to the receipt store.

11. A system comprising:
-
a device reader that receives, from a device, profile information that comprises payment account information of a customer and contact information of said customer, wherein said contact information identifies said customer by an e-mail address, an Instant Message (IM) address, a Uniform Resource Locator (URL), a phone number, or a Short Message Service (SMS) identifier; a point-of-sale component that performs a transaction at a location at which said customer and said point-of-sale component are physically present together, and that generates a partial receipt for said transaction, said partial receipt not including an amount paid by said customer for transaction and not including a form of payment used for said transaction; and a first component that receives said partial receipt from said point-of-sale component, that generates a receipt based on said partial receipt by adding said amount paid and said form of payment to said partial receipt, and that causes said receipt to be sent, via a network, to a receipt store identified by said contact information, wherein said receipt store is remote from said location at which said transaction occurs, said first component being separate from said point-of-sale component. - View Dependent Claims (12, 13, 14, 15, 16, 17)
